Job Description

We are seeking an ambitious and creative Content Manager to join our growing team in Manhattan, New York. Under the direction of the Director, Marketing and Communications, you will be responsible for the development, creation and execution of content across the agency’s social media channels. Through their online marketing efforts, the Content Manager will play a key role in building brand recognition of the Enthuse Foundation, a start-up non-profit foundation that supports female entrepreneurs.


The ideal candidate possesses a demonstrated interest in entrepreneurship and helping women-owned businesses.

Duties and Responsibilities: 

  • Responsible for developing content ideas, researching and writing, editing and posting content to Enthuse website, social media accounts and blogs. 
  • Monitor, track, and document content results; analyze data and customer responses.
  • Create content marketing calendar to ensure regular content release across all platforms.
  • Assist with writing case studies, semi-monthly newsletters, PR opportunities and award submissions.
  • Create and manage a resources database for the Foundation.
  • Responsible for assisting with the planning and execution of Enthuse Foundation events.
  • Oversee Mentor and Book Club programs.
  • Other responsibilities as assigned.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's Degree in Journalism, English, Marketing or a related field.
  • A minimum of 2 years of experience in content development and community management.
  • Non-profit experience, female-focused philanthropy and understanding of mentorship programs preferred.
  • Understanding of content marketing tactics such as SEO, digital advertising and social media marketing.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ills. 
  •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ision. 
  • Strong project management and organizational skills; the ability to successfully manage multiple projects.
  • Proven success in coordination of special events of various sizes and scope.
